本篇文章给大家谈谈c语言g_n,以及c语言gn是什么意思对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
c语言n!怎么求啊?
求n!就是n的阶乘首先打开vc++ 0软件,准备一个新的c语言文件,命名为multiply.cpp,然后引入C语言基本库,创建一个main函数:然后在man函数中输入代码。
第三步、就是把sum初始化,为千万不要为0,保证后面的结果不出问题。第四步、就是输入一个n,用来求n的阶乘,别忘了在前面提示一下。第五步、就是利用for循环来求阶乘。
C语言中“--n”是什么意思?
1、n是输入格式化控制字符,用在scanf或类似的sscanf、fscanf等函数中,意思是把刚刚接收的数据的“字符个数”赋给对应的变量。
2、n--和--n的意思都是让n自减1。1: n--这个表达式的值是n自减之前的值。如:int n=5;int a=n--;此时a的值为5。2 :--n就是在表达式中,先把n自减,再取n的值进行运算。
3、C语言中可以使用两个很特别的单目运算符,这两个运算符是:++ 、-- “++”称为自增运算符,“--”称为自减运算符。它们既可以出现在运算对象的前面,如++N;又可以出现在运算对象的后面,如N++。
C语言和汇编怎样引用对方定义的变量
1、这属于内联汇编的内容,C语言本身是支持内联汇编的,一般在内联的汇编代码中,可以直接使用可见的C语言变量。
2、用指针。以32位系统为例:unsigned short int ptr=0x00000000;然后就可以利用ptr管理地址为0,1的内存空间了。
3、最简单的诶办法就是 引用伪变量。比如:unsigned int uni;∶_AX=uni;然后在汇编中直接 取 AX 的值就是了。
4、首先要理解汇编里的变量是如何存放的,因为C语言的实现又跟操作系统有关,所以又必须理解C语言在这个系统里是如何实现的。用汇编语言写个call,c语言里按照这个call约定调用这个call,就可以调用call里面的变量了。
5、汇编语言程序中所用的符号命名,要等同于C语言调用时用的符号前面加一个下划线。
6、首先要想跨文件使用同一个变量,该变量必须定义成全局变量。其次在另外的文件引用文件外的全局变量,引用者必须用extern来声明变量。最后必须在函数中去操作该变量即可。
C语言中说字符串结尾应该是字符\n,但是看我在下面的代码中结尾是字符...
1、长度是14,因为用strlen(s)时,是不包括最后的字符串结束符的\t是转义字符,不计入,\也会翻译成转义字符,不计入,\n也是,所以是14。
2、因为楼主在字符数组的结尾没有手动加上‘\0’的结束符,所以后面会有一些乱 码。我记得这个是书上的问题。下面是我的代码,可以参考下。
3、\0其实就是0,字符串存入字符数组的时候最后一个字符作为字符串的结尾。告诉计算机,这个字符串结束了。(2)\n是回车换行,挺长用的。比如:printf(%d\n,a);就会输出a的值以后,自动换行。
4、在C语言里面,字符数组结束的标志是遇到\0。在你的程序里,显然没有结束符,所以编译器不知道字符数组在何时结束。另外要说明的是,结束符\0也要战用一个字符。用字符串给数组赋值编译器会自动在末尾加上结束符。
5、\n’是两个字节。如果是char 型,那么是占用1个字节,8位。如果是string型,应该是两个字节,16位,因为末尾还有个\0字符。比如:char c = a;//它占用一个字符 char c[] = a;//占用两个。
c语言g_n的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言gn是什么意思、c语言g_n的信息别忘了在本站进行查找喔。